Bruce StewartWore my 1932 Rolex Oyster yesterday. I started with a NOS 9 ct case that I bought from a guy in NYC. The alligator strap came from Thailand. The correct 10 1/2 L. Hunter movement and dial was sourced off of eBay. The restoration involved a COA on the movement, correcting some cross threading on one of the mounting screw holes, replacing a missing leg on the dial, and resizing the hands. I also had to do a cosmetic repair to part of the "5" and the "railroad track next to the five. I just finished the project yesterday....whoohoo!!!
